2004 Tour – China & Malaysia

On 21 November 2004, the Australian Chinese Basketball Association departed Sydney’s International Airport for an 18 day tour of China and Malaysia.

The tour made memorable stops in the Chinese cities of Guangzhou, Fo Shan, Shantou, Shenzhen, Puyun and Long Gong, and the Malaysian cities of Kuala Lumpur, Ipoh and Penang.

Overall, the Dragons managed a fantastic performance by finishing with nine wins from their ten games. Most of the games were very close, and often was not decided until the final minute with free throws, or great defence. The Queen Beez finished the basketball tour with four wins out of their eleven games. Whilst not coming away with an overall winning record for the tour, the Queen Beez once again enjoyed the experience to play against the more experienced semi-professional teams. The veteran team participated in the World Invitation Tournament for Veterans in Shantou, China. This year a total of 183 teams participated across the various men’s and women’s divisions.
